Gregor Mendel was regarded as the "Father of Genetics" because of his outstanding contribution to discovering the pattern of inheritance. In his experiments with purebreeding purple and white-flowered plants, he discovered that the F1 offsprings were all purple-flowered.
This observation made him to propose his LAW OF DOMINANCE, which states that one allele of a gene is capable of masking the expression of another in a heterozygous state. In this case of flower colour gene, the allele for purple color (P) is masking the gene of the white colour (p) in a combined state. Hence, purple allele is said to be DOMINANT over white allele.

Each element absorbs light at specific wavelengths unique to that atom. When astronomers look at an object's spectrum, they can determine its composition based on these wavelengths. The most common method astronomers use to determine the composition of stars, planets, and other objects is spectroscopy.
